Hi Tony, thanks for this "contrarian" view. Everything is possible. However, the article's arguments are weak.
"cinderella metal, silver, being slow to authenticate the move as it normally might." - Not anymore.
"they tend to buy on the benchmark (or fix) and these purchases are not." - I would not make a lot from that.
"LBMA vault data" - again, very weak argument.
"It appears a counterparty has taken a particulalry large bet on gold and squeezing the market"
Not possible to keep this in secret. Options bet of this size could be done only with multiple bullion/investment banks. Everyone from every gold trading desk would already be talking about that. Besides, no hedge fund would dare to do this in the current environment, inflicting regulation scrutiny.
Again, everything is possible, but I would not hold my breath.
